dottle

 

Definitions from WordNet

Noun dottle has 1 sense
  1. dottle - the residue of partially burnt tobacco left caked in the bowl of a pipe after smoking
    --1 is a kind of
    residue

Dottle

Description:

Dottle is a noun referring to the small bits of tobacco left in the bottom of a pipe after smoking. It can also be used as a verb to describe the act of removing the dottle from a pipe.

Senses:

Noun:

  1. Residue of tobacco left in the bowl of a pipe after smoking.

Verb:

  1. To remove the dottle from a pipe.

Sample Sentences:

Sense 1:

  1. After finishing his pipe, he emptied the dottle into the ashtray.
  2. The dottle had a strong aroma of tobacco.
  3. He carefully scraped the dottle out of the pipe with a tamper.

Sense 2:

  1. Once he finished smoking, he dottled the pipe and cleaned it.
  2. She always dottles her pipe before putting it away.
